The Muscle Couple with some surreal pictures from the La Canada and Los Angeles Crest National Forest Fires.
We live in Eaton Canyon in Pasadena(just East of Altadena on the fire map) at the base of the San Gabriel Valley Canyons.(Angeles Crest)
These raging wildfires are less than 2.5 miles away from our community.
We’re enclosing some pictures we shot while driving around today.
These are truly amazing shots.

The Smoke in these canyons is less than 5 miles from our house!

The Flames are hard to see in this photo but they are close to the Dark Smoke Plumes.

It's Crazy to be Driving Around on a Sunny Day and Have this as the Vista!
We actually took some amazing photos this evening but you’d need an infra-red coder to view the flames in the darkness. Needless to say the fire is not even close to being contained and judging from looking out my 2nd floor window, on it’s way closer to the homes just north of us.
Our hats and hearts go out to the brave men and women of the LA County Fire Dept who continue to put their lives at risk protecting the thousands of homes lining the Foothill Region. As of this moment, not a single home has been destroyed. A truly amazing accomplishment.
Right now the winds are still at bay and Fire officials believe they will be able to contain the fire with controlled burns and backfires at some point in the next 5 days.
